Nacogdoches organization repairing homes for needy East Texans asking for help

NACOGDOCHES, Texas (KETK) – Several churches in Nacogdoches are coming together to serve others by repairing the homes of East Texans in need. However, the cost of inflation leaves the group in need of donations to get the job done.
The organization is called MissionNAC. There are about 20 houses currently under construction, but a team leader says the cost of plywood and other materials has multiplied, making the need for donations greater.
They have about 500 volunteers, who each pay a $30 fee that helps fund their projects. But $30 doesn’t last like it used to.
“The 2×4s have gone up three, four times, and we’re using a lot of 2-by-4s. Shingles, yeah, everything has had its detrimental effect,” says Brian Kile, one of the crew chiefs.
They fix everything from paint touch-ups to complete floor replacements and even get on the roof if needed. A lady who is redoing her house had a falling floor. So the band completely tore up the floor and added a new backing and carpet. It’s something volunteers are grateful to be a part of.
“We all said, ‘serve to love, love to serve,’ and I feel more blessed than her,” Brian said.
